WASHINGTON, D.C. – Today, Congressman Mike Turner (OH-10) released the following statement on Rep. Gerry Connolly’s (VA-11) decision not to seek reelection to the U.S. House of Representatives:
“Gerry Connolly is a dear friend and dedicated public servant who has spent more than 30 years serving our nation. Over the past decade, Gerry and I have forged a close friendship through our work together as members of the U.S. delegation to the NATO Parliamentary Assembly.
“As President of NATO-PA, Gerry led with strength and dignity during one of the most challenging moments in recent history — the launch of Russia's illegal invasion of Ukraine in February 2022. Additionally, Gerry has been relentless in his pursuit of establishing a Centre for Democratic Resilience at NATO headquarters, which will recognize the importance of strengthening democratic institutions across NATO allies and partner nations. His unwavering commitment to upholding democracy against authoritarianism should be applauded.
“Gerry has had a stellar career serving the people of Virginia’s 11th district. My prayers are with him and his family as he courageously battles this disease.”
